The Houston Rockets traded Chris Paul to the Oklahoma City Thunder (in the Russell Westbrook deal) over the offseason, and Paul put on a show against his former team on Thursday night. Paul had 18 points, six rebounds, five assists, and four steals in the Thunder’s 113-92 win over the Rockets.

And CP3 added an absolutely filthy, streeball-esque highlight in the fourth quarter, when he nutmegged Houston’s Isaiah Hartenstein before sinking a floater.

Cp3 turns 35 in May, but the nine-time All-Star still has plenty of skill and tricks up his sleeve. He’s played a big part in the surprising Thunder winning 11 of their last 13 games.
